Key Responsibilities
Perform high rigging for construction, millwright, and maintenance work
Lead and check work of lower-classification employees
Work from blueprints, specifications, and verbal instructions
Rig block and tackle and other moving aids
Operate powered rolling equipment and cranes
Determine work sequence and troubleshoot problems
Use hand signals to direct cranes and forklifts
Lock out, tag out, and try out machinery
Move, set up, and level machines
Perform demolition projects and excavation work
Fabricate steel cables and perform concrete work
Operate lifts and material handling equipment
